There is almost no precipitation at summer yet there are hot winds which occasionally grow to sandstorms. The capital located on highlands in north-western part of the country temperature is even lower – 33 ☌ (91 ☏). At August, the hottest month of a year, daytime temperature rises to 38-42 ☌ (100-108 ☏). Highest temperatures are in coasts of the Dead Sea and in the Valley of Jordan River. This season in the Jordan is hot and dry. However evenings are still pretty cool (except coasts). At May average temperature of air and water reaches 29-35 ☌ (84-95 ☏) and 24 ☌ (75 ☏) respectively.
